HTC has announced the One Mini 2, a smaller version of HTC One M8. Since it is a “smaller” version, naturally the price is much lower than the M8; at the same time users have to compromise on certain features and fancies.

The One Mini 2 is slightly larger than the One Mini but the curved design makes the phone a winner – holding the phone is much comfortable with the curved design. The phone has a 4.5″ display.

The phone boasts a 13 MP rear camera and a 5 MP front camera, plus Boomsound dual front speakers. The 13 MP camera has caught the interest of users who are fond of taking pictures heavily with their phone. Both the cameras can record 1080p video. The camera is really a plus with the phone.

The phone comes with Android 4.4 Kitkat. The main downside is that the phone has only a Snapdragon 400 chipset and has a 720p screen. However we must understand that since this is a mini version of the big brother M8, the price is much lower – so it is not surprising that we have to compromise on certain features.

Nevertheless, the phone has a solid metal build just like its brother – so you can flaunt it.

Other specs of the HTC One Mini 2 are the following: 1 GB RAM, 2100mAh battery, 4G LTE connectivity,  16GB internal storage (expandable to an additional 128 GB via the microSD card slot), Ultrapixel camera tech and BSI sensor, microUSB 2.0, dual-band Wi-Fi 802, and Bluetooth 4.0.

Mini 2 will come in Silver, Grey and Gold just like M8. The phone will go on sale in June.
